Viettel soars in global valuable brand ranking

Vietnam’s largest telecommunication service provider Viettel has climbed 126 positions to be ranked 355th most valuable brand in the world in 2020.

Currently valued at VND134.9 trillion ($5.8 billion), up 34 percent compared to 2019, Viettel was placed 102nd in Asia, and 7th in Southeast Asia, according to Brand Finance, a London-based branded business valuation consultancy.

The company saw its consolidated revenues increase by 7.4 percent in 2019 over 2018, and it currently occupies 53 percent of Vietnam’s mobile network market.

Viettel successfully operated 5G phone calls on self-developed equipment on January 17, and is expected to commercially launch 5G services this June. It plans to expand its operations both within Vietnam as well as in 10 foreign markets.

There are just 36 telecom companies in the 2020 listing of the world’s top 500 brands by value. Most of the  36 branks saw their values fall. Over the past five years, the combined value of all telecom brands in the Brand Finance Global 500 listing has fallen slightly, reaching $558.4 billion in 2020, compared to $567.7 billion in 2015.

The Brand Finance Global 500 list covers 10 sectors in 29 markets, using a sample size of 50,000 adults over 18 years old. For the latest ranking, surveys were conducted online from September to December 2019.
